v0.0.43: FC-P3-T4 — voice calls via WZP audio bridge
Web client: - After call goes "active", connects to WZP web bridge WS - Mic capture: getUserMedia → ScriptProcessor → PCM int16 frames → WS - Playback: WS → PCM int16 → Float32 → AudioContext.createBufferSource - Room name derived from peer fingerprint (deterministic) - Relay address fetched from /v1/wzp/relay-config - Audio auto-starts on accept/answer, auto-stops on hangup/reject - startAudio()/stopAudio() manage full lifecycle TUI: - /call shows "Audio: use web client for voice (TUI audio coming soon)" - Signaling works, audio requires web client for now This completes the last critical task — voice calls work end-to-end: User A calls → signaling via featherChat WS → User B accepts → both connect to WZP relay → audio flows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
